Output 8bfaf95044267b48c2de5393042a297de44bcdf558e0df4ba7cac643ff0895bc:68

value
2097152
script pubkey
OP_0 OP_PUSHBYTES_20 8b5b7cd332969271e2fa99f6407916f01684b180
address
bc1q3ddhe5ejj6f8rch6n8myq7gk7qtgfvvqerjvl4
transaction
8bfaf95044267b48c2de5393042a297de44bcdf558e0df4ba7cac643ff0895bc